A rectangular area is to be enclosed by a wall on one side and fencing on the other three sides. If 18 meters of fencing are use
Rashid [163]

Answer:

A = L W= 9*\frac{9}{2}=\frac{81}{2} m^2

Step-by-step explanation:

For this case we assume that the total perimeter is 18 ft, we have a wall and the two sides perpendicular to the wall measure x units each one so then the side above measure P-2x= 18-2x.

And we are interested about the maximum area.

For this case since we have a recatangular area we know that the area is given by:

A= LW

Where L is the length and W the width, if we replace from the values on the figure we got:

A(x)= x *(18-2x) = 18x -2x^2

And as we can see we have a quadratic function for the area, in order to maximize this function we can use derivates.

If we find the first derivate respect to x we got:

\frac{dA}{dx} = 18-4x=0

We set this equal to 0 in order to find the critical points and for this case we got:

18-4x=0

And if we solve for x we got:

x=\frac{18}{4}=\frac{9}{2} m

We can calculate the second derivate for A(x) and we got:

\frac{d^2 A}{dx^2}= -4

And since the second derivate is negative then the value for x would represent a maximum.

Then since we have the value for x we can solve for the other side like this:

L= 18-2x = 18-2 \frac{9}{2}= 18-9 =9m

And then since we have the two values we can find the maximum area like this:

A = L W= 9*\frac{9}{2}=\frac{81}{2} m^2

Stefan sells Jim a bicycle for $138 and a helmet for $16.The total cost for Jim is 140% of what Stefan spent originally to buy t
alukav5142 [94]

Answer:

$110, $44

Step-by-step explanation:

Let x = the total cost to Stefan

Jim buys for:

bicycle: $138

helmet: $16

total: $138 + $16 = $154

Jim's price of $154 is 140% of Stefan's cost, x.

154 = 140% × x

1.4x = 154

x = 110

Stefan spent $110.

Stefan's profit:

$154 - $110 = $44

Answer: $110, $44
